Frances E. Spengler, 92, widow of Ken Spengler, passed away October 30, 2019.

She was born July 30, 1927 in Lexington, Ky. to the late Francis and Catherine Aharn Thornton. She was a member of Emmanuel Episcopal Church in Winchester where she served as secretary and a volunteer at Clark Regional Medical Center for 20 years.

She is survived by her son Larry (Betsy) Spengler, brother Jerry (Alice) Thornton, of Tennessee; son-in-law Paul Osborne (Palmer Tolly, friend); brother-n-law Lee Terrell; grandchildren, Stephanie Osborne (Jonathan) Greene, Amanda (Eric) Miller, Lindsey (Jacob) Frick, Jessica Spengler; great grandchildren, Maxwell Osborne Nelson, Samantha Clair Nelson, Ethan Coleman Ingram, Loryan Faith Ingram, Olivia Grace Ingram, Maloree Sue Miller, Preston Ray Miller, Jacob Myles Frick II, Jaxon Mattox Frick, Charlee Elizabeth Frick and Adriana Rose Engelbracht.

Services will be on Tuesday November 5,2019 at 11:00 am with Rev. Jim Trimble officiating. Visitation will be from 10:00 am till the hour of service. Burial will be in the church garden. Donations may be sent to Emmanuel Episcopal Church, 2410 Lexington Rd. Winchester, Ky. 40391 or Hospice East, 407 Shoppers Dr. Winchester, Ky.

Rolan G. Taylor Funeral Home in charge of arrangements.
